Taft was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their fourth straight loss. They lost 15-0 to the Dayton Pirates. That's two games in a row now that the Tigers have lost by exactly 15 runs.
Taft's defeat dropped their record down to 4-9. As for Dayton,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 13-2.
Taft w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next game, a 10-0 loss against Yamhill-Carlton on the 27th. As for Dayton,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 16-0 victory against Amity on the 27th.
